For the vast majority of adults, partaking in physical activity should not pose any
problem or hazard to health. This short questionnaire has been designed to identify the
small number of people for whom physical activity might be inappropriate or those who
should receive medical advice regarding the type of activity most suitable for them.

If you answered NO to all questions & answered accurately, you have reasonable assurance of your suitability for physical activity participation. If you answered YES to one or more of the questions, it is recommended that you consult your Doctor before partaking in physical activity.
